- Search by titles or clips as described above.
- The search results are shown as a list of entries. Right click on the required entry. A context menu opens. The menu has two items: Video request and Frame request.
- Select the Video request menu item. A dialog form for the request opens. There is another way to open this form: Select an entry from the list and click Video.
- The Date and time and Camera fields are filled in automatically.
- Use the Duration (sec.) field to limit video clips by time.
- If you want to decrease network load, set the Transfer Rate (KB/s) field to the appropriate value.
in In the Start area, select the time for sending the request: Click either the Immediately option button or By schedule option button.
Set the waiting time by using the Data timeout (sec.) field.
If the check box Open immediately is selected, the data is put into the video archive and shown immediately. Otherwise, the data is only sent to the archive. To view such data, use the Monitoring reports component.
If you try to set the value of the Duration (sec.) field to over 120, the value of 120 is offered. This is done to remind the user that such requests can export a big data file from a video archive on Agent Of Control's side. If you want to turn this limitation off, click Settings in the lower-left area of the Archive Search area. A window opens. In the window, change the value of the Maximum duration for loaded video (sec) field.
After you fill in all the fields, click Create.
You will get to the Downloads tab where the task performance process is displayed. While the video clip is being downloaded, it file size, loaded size, and transfer rate are shown. You can pause the download at any moment by clicking Pause.
Info title Note. In case data have stopped coming during the download, for example if connection with the object is lost, download will be restarted after a random time interval from 1 to 60 seconds. In case of the attempt failure, attempts will be made at intervals of 1 minute.
Information on the time remaining to the restart is displayed in the Comment field. Any time you can restart loading manually using the Restart button.
- If the data is loaded successfully and the Open immediately check box is selected, the downloaded clip is played with Axxon Player.
